Cancellation Pluralsight: Easy Method

What is Pluralsight

Pluralsight is an online learning platform that offers technology-focused video courses, hands-on labs, and certification prep for individuals and businesses. It provides a searchable library of professionally produced technical content across software development, IT operations, data, and security topics.

How to cancel Pluralsight

  • Web (direct from Pluralsight): Sign in to your account, go to Account Settings → Subscription & Billing → Cancel → Confirm cancellation. Your access typically remains until the end of the current billing period.
  • Google Play: If you subscribed through Google Play, open the Play Store app or your Google account subscriptions page and manage/cancel the Pluralsight subscription there.
  • Apple App Store: If you subscribed through Apple, cancel via iOS Settings (your Apple ID subscriptions), the App Store on macOS, or iTunes on Windows.

What happens when you cancel

When you cancel a Pluralsight subscription, you generally retain access to the service until the end of the paid billing period; cancelling prevents future automatic renewal. Your account, profile, and learning history are typically preserved according to Pluralsight’s data retention practices, but access to premium features will end when the subscription expires. If you subscribed through a third party (Google Play or Apple), cancellation through that third party will end renewals under their billing system.

Will I get a refund?

Pluralsight’s stated policy for individual monthly and annual subscriptions is that refunds are not offered; you can cancel to avoid future renewals but refunds are not provided in most cases. Free trials are 10 days; if you do not cancel before day 11 the trial typically converts to a paid subscription and is not refunded. EU consumer-rights commentary notes a possible 14-day withdrawal in some EU contexts, but that does not guarantee refunds for Canadian customers and Pluralsight’s terms often state no refunds.

Your consumer rights in Canada

Pluralsight’s non-refund policy for digital subscriptions generally applies in Canada. Canadian consumer-protection law does not impose a universal 14-day refund right for digital subscriptions; rights can vary by province and by the specifics of the transaction. If you believe an auto-renewal occurred without proper notice, or a promotional promise (for example, “lifetime” access) was not honoured, you may have grounds to dispute the charge under provincial consumer protection or deceptive-practices rules. Consider reviewing local statutes and, if necessary, contact your payment provider or credit card issuer to pursue a charge dispute. If you send formal notices, using registered mail gives proof of delivery and is recommended when you are notifying Pluralsight of a contractual dispute or seeking a formal response.

Customer experiences

Public reviews are mixed. Many industry review sites note that Pluralsight is well-regarded for ease of use, up-to-date technical content, and professional production values. At the same time, forums and review platforms include complaints about difficulty cancelling, unexpected charges, and slow or unhelpful customer support responses. Specific threads have raised issues where third-party promises (for example, prior “lifetime” access offers after acquisitions) were later altered, and some business users reported denied refunds for unused auto-renewed subscriptions consistent with the stated terms.

Common mistakes

Users commonly assume cancelling the app removes the subscription - but if the subscription was set up through Google Play or Apple, you must cancel through that platform. Another frequent error is waiting until the billing date; cancelling after the renewal posts generally stops future charges but does not refund the latest period. Relying only on verbal confirmation from support without written proof can make disputes harder to resolve; always retain screenshots or copies of any correspondence and confirmations.
